Commissioning engineer Instrumentation and Automation
Planned start date: 01/10/2025
Planned end date: 31/10/2026
Workschedule: 5 days a week / Normal workingdays
Responsibilities
Lead the preparation and execution of commissioning activities within automation and instrumentation.
Follow up on MC verification and manage handover scope to Commissioning.
Perform handover from Commissioning to Operations.
Provide guidance and support to colleagues and management on commissioning matters.
Work in close cooperation with the project team and the Client’s team.
Education
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Engineering, or
Technical College diploma in relevant discipline.
Experience
5–10 years of relevant commissioning experience.
Previous experience in a similar position is required.
Qualifications
Familiarity with electronic tools for project follow-up and delivery is an advantage.
Dedicated, independent, and reliable professional with a collaborative mindset.
Strong focus on HSE and able to act as a role model for safety performance.
Proficient in both Norwegian and English.
Required Certifications
EX: Basic EX course (6–8 hours online or 22.5 hours classroom).
FSE: High and low voltage with first aid.
AT / SJA: Valid certification.
